Hi fellow Toodledooians,

I use subtasks a lot. For example, I have a 5-step mini-project where the third step is "wait for John to review the document". So, I make a task with a few subtasks, one being "wait for John to review the document" with status "Waiting".

In the webinterface, I sometimes want to see all and subtasks with status "Waiting". I do this by clicking "Status" in the top left (View by), and then click "Waiting" below that.

This indeed shows all waiting tasks. However, for most of those tasks, I don't know by just the description of the subtask what the parent task is that this subtask belongs to. Just seeing "wait for John to review the document" doesn't tell me enough. This information is already in the parent task, but I don't see that. The parent task has status "Active", because this mini-project is active. I don't want to have to update the status of the parent task whenever I complete one of the subtasks.

I have played with all the task/subtask settings, even enabling "Indented mode shows all subtasks nested, even if the parent shouldn't be visible.", but I can't get the parent task to show up.

How can I accomplish this?

Thank you for your time.

The "Indented mode shows all subtasks nested, even if the parent shouldn't be visible." should have taken care of this. Can you please create a support ticket and attach a screenshot that demonstrates the problem in your account?
